Cast-On Bonnet Using Braided Fishing Line
Cast-on bonnets are important tools for our hobby and having good ones means fewer headaches and vexations -- especially when you have to start a project over (and over and over!). Braided fishing is both sturdy and flexible and it runs through our machines without difficulty. Important: Use 60-80 pound test line and make sure it is braided (not single filament which won't work at all).
